Factors

Global Market Conditions: Overall market sentiment, economic growth, and geopolitical events influence investor confidence and fund flows, impacting fund prices.

Underlying Assets' Performance: The fund's performance is directly tied to the performance of the assets (e.g., stocks, bonds) it holds. Positive asset returns increase fund value.

Interest Rates: Changes in interest rates, especially in the Eurozone, affect bond valuations and influence the attractiveness of fixed-income assets within the fund.

Fund Expenses: Management fees, operational costs, and other expenses charged by the fund reduce net returns and can influence the fund's price relative to its peers.

Fund Flows: Large inflows increase demand and can push prices up, while large outflows force the fund to sell assets, potentially lowering prices.

Currency Fluctuations: As an EU fund, currency exchange rates (especially Euro vs. other major currencies) impact returns for investors in other currency zones.
